William Penn Statue

penn statue
  • Designer: Alexander Milne Calder (1846-1923)
  • Tallest statue on any building in the world
  • Height: 37 feet
  • Weight: 53,348 lbs. (27 tons)
  • Material: Bronze

Rig Statue
  • Set on tower Nov. 28, 1894 ( Displayed in courtyard for one year prior to raising)
  • Statue constructed in 14 pieces
  • Fabricator : Tacony Iron & Metal

  • Hat Circumference: 23 ft.
  • Face (hat to chin): 3 ft. 3 in.
  • Eye length: 12 in.
  • Eye width: 4 in.
  • Nose length: 18 in.
  • Mouth width: 14 in.
  • Waist circumference: 24 ft
  • Legs (ankle to knee): 10 ft.

  • Hair Strand: 4 ft.
  • Finger length: 2ft 6in.
  • Fingernail length: 3 in.
  • Arm length: 12 ft 6 in.
  • Foot length: 5 ft.
  • Foot width: 22 in.

  • Coat cuffs length: 3 ft
  • access Access: Public access ends at an observation deck just below the statue. The statue is hollow & a small maintenance access tunnel through the statue leads to a tiny (22" dia.) hatch at the top of the hat.
